How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Columbus?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Columbus Studio Apartments | $1,233 | $300 | $2,879 |
| Columbus 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,447 | $300 | $4,991 |
| Columbus 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,757 | $300 | $10,000+ |
| Columbus 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,168 | $550 | $8,409 |
| Columbus 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$745 | $10,000+ |
| Columbus 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,881 | $959 | $6,989 |
| Columbus 6 Bedroom Apartments | $4,060 | $2,400 | $7,364 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Furnished Columbus Apartments
What is the Cheapest Furnished apartment in Columbus?
Currently the most affordable Furnished Apartment in Columbus is at The Abigail listed at $695.
How much is the average rent for a Furnished Columbus Apartment?
The average rent for a Furnished Apartment in Columbus is $2,101.
What is the largest Furnished Columbus Apartment for rent?
Today's Furnished apartment with the most square footage in Columbus is a 2,895 square feet unit starting from $4,598 at 1140 Hamlet St.
What is the average size for Columbus Furnished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Furnished rental in Columbus is currently at 817 sq ft.
